## Step 4: Enable log compaction

Before migrating topics from the old Quillbus brokers, enable compaction on the new Fernqueue cluster so keyed messages retain only their latest value. New team members: compaction runs per-topic, not cluster-wide, so verify each migrated topic individually. Apply the compaction settings below to every topic in the migration batch before cutover.

settings of hadug-yagug:
[sorwyn]
host = sorwyn.paliqworks.internal
user = sorwyn_svc
database = sorwyn_prod

## Runbook: Telemetry payload compression on Grayfen

The Grayfen collector compresses telemetry batches before upload. If customers report delayed metrics, check whether compression is falling back to the slow codec — it happens when payloads exceed the batch ceiling. Restarting the agent resets the codec selection. Do not disable compression outright; the ingest tier rejects raw payloads. Verify the agent is running with these values.

service settings:
novath:
  pin: 1396
  tenant: pelys
  seal: seal_ccc035e1
  metrics_host: metrics.novath.qorvelworks.test
  standby_team: fraeth
  escalation: drueth-zorok
  nonce: 61d508

Release channel — ChipGate reader firmware for the Orvano Marathon. This build hardens the RFID ingest path: signed chip payloads are now verified before queuing, and malformed reads are dropped with an audit entry rather than retried. Please review the verification flow before race weekend. The firmware trace token for this release follows below.

pipeline stamp: htk3_a71